(ARWR) reported a fiscal first-quarter 2026 loss per share of -$0.93, beating the consensus estimate of -$1.211 by 23.2%. The company recorded no material revenue during the quarter, consistent with its pre-commercial stage. Shares reacted positively, rising approximately 4.98% in after-hours trading as investors focused on the narrower‑than‑expected bottom line.

The narrower quarterly loss was driven primarily by disciplined operating expense management. Research and development (R&D) costs, which represent the bulk of Arrowhead’s spending, came in below internal forecasts as the company prioritized later‑stage programs. General and administrative expenses also moderated relative to the prior‑year period. While no product revenue was reported, Arrowhead continued to advance its RNA interference (RNAi) pipeline. Key highlights include ongoing phase 3 studies for plozasiran (cardiovascular) and ARO‑APOC3 (dyslipidemia), as well as early‑stage clinical work in muscle‑targeted therapeutics. The company maintained a strong cash position, with cash and investments sufficient to fund operations well into 2027 under current plans. Management emphasized that the absence of revenue was expected, as the firm remains focused on clinical development and does not yet have a commercial product. The reported loss of -$0.93 per share marked a notable improvement over the consensus expectation, reflecting effective cost controls and timing of certain preclinical activities.

Arrowhead did not provide formal fiscal 2026 revenue guidance, consistent with its pre‑revenue stage. However, management reiterated its expectation to report multiple data readouts across its pipeline over the coming quarters. The company anticipates that pivotal results from the plozasiran and ARO‑APOC3 programs could support regulatory filings in the second half of calendar 2026. Strategic priorities include scaling up manufacturing capabilities and expanding partnerships to co‑develop certain assets. Potential risk factors include clinical trial delays, regulatory setbacks, and the need for additional financing if partnership milestones are not realized. Arrowhead also faces competitive pressure from other RNAi and gene‑editing therapies. The company has noted that operating expenses may increase as late‑stage enrollment accelerates. Investors should watch for updates on the timing of the next phase 3 readout and any news of collaboration agreements that could provide non‑dilutive capital. Arrowhead’s cash runway provides some buffer against adverse events, but the absence of revenue continues to leave the stock sensitive to pipeline setbacks.

Arrowhead’s share price rose 4.98% following the earnings release, reflecting relief that the loss was smaller than anticipated. The positive surprise helped offset lingering concerns about the company’s lack of near‑term revenue. Analysts have remained cautious, noting that Arrowhead’s value is highly dependent on successful late‑stage trial outcomes. Several sell‑side firms rate the stock as a “hold” or equivalent, with price targets based on risk‑adjusted probability of approval for lead candidates. The narrowing loss could improve near‑term sentiment, but the absence of revenue and the long timeline to potential commercialization may limit significant upside until clearer clinical data emerge. What to watch next: enrollment updates for plozasiran and ARO‑APOC3 phase 3 studies, any new partnership announcements, and the company’s cash burn rate. A large capital raise remains a possibility if development milestones are delayed. Arrowhead’s ability to control costs while advancing its pipeline will be a key focus for investors in the coming quarters.
